Liberia’s First Lady announced 52 medical scholarships for Liberian doctors and highlighted her girls' education program.
The Merck Foundation’s 12th Africa Asia Luminary conference in Banjul, The Gambia, brought together First Ladies and health leaders from several African nations.
Dr. Rasha Kelej, CEO of the Merck Foundation, met with Liberia’s First Lady, Mrs. Kartumu Yarta Boakai, to announce 52 medical scholarships awarded to Liberian doctors in key specialties, enabling many to become the first specialists in their fields.
The First Lady also highlighted her “Educating Linda” program, supporting 40 underprivileged girls annually.
Discussions focused on advancing healthcare, expanding medical training, and strengthening Liberia’s health system through collaborative initiatives.
